Member Function Documentation

◆ execute()

StatusCode Gaudi::TestSuite::StringKeyEx::execute ( )
overridevirtual

execution of the Testalg

Implements Algorithm.

Definition at line 66 of file StringKeyEx.cpp.

66  {
67  // 1. check the settings of key from the properties
68  always() << "The Key : " << Gaudi::Utils::toString( m_key.value() ) << endmsg;
69  always() << "The Keys : " << Gaudi::Utils::toString( m_keys.value() ) << endmsg;
70  //
71 
72  // prepare some maps
73  typedef std::map<std::string, int> MAP1;
77 
78  typedef std::map<Key, int> MAP01;
79  typedef GaudiUtils::Map<Key, int> MAP02;
80  typedef GaudiUtils::HashMap<Key, int> MAP03;
81  typedef GaudiUtils::VectorMap<Key, int> MAP04;
82 
83  MAP1 map1;
84  MAP2 map2;
85  MAP3 map3;
86  MAP4 map4;
87 
88  MAP01 map01;
89  MAP02 map02;
90  MAP03 map03;
91  MAP04 map04;
92 
93  for ( Keys::const_iterator it = m_keys.begin(); m_keys.end() != it; ++it ) {
94  int index = it - m_keys.begin();
95 
96  map1.insert( std::make_pair( *it, index ) );
97  map2.insert( std::make_pair( *it, index ) );
98  map3.insert( std::make_pair( *it, index ) );
99  map4.insert( std::make_pair( *it, index ) );
100 
101  map01.insert( std::make_pair( *it, index ) );
102  map02.insert( std::make_pair( *it, index ) );
103  map03.insert( std::make_pair( *it, index ) );
104  map04.insert( std::make_pair( *it, index ) );
105  }
106 
107  always() << "Map 1:" << Gaudi::Utils::toString( map1 ) << endmsg;
108  always() << "Map 2:" << Gaudi::Utils::toString( map2 ) << endmsg;
109  always() << "Map 3:" << Gaudi::Utils::toString( map3 ) << endmsg;
110  always() << "Map 4:" << Gaudi::Utils::toString( map4 ) << endmsg;
111 
112  always() << "Map01:" << Gaudi::Utils::toString( map01 ) << endmsg;
113  always() << "Map02:" << Gaudi::Utils::toString( map02 ) << endmsg;
114  always() << "Map03:" << Gaudi::Utils::toString( map03 ) << endmsg;
115  always() << "Map04:" << Gaudi::Utils::toString( map04 ) << endmsg;
116 
117  always() << "check for StringKey " << Gaudi::Utils::toString( m_key.value() ) << endmsg;
118 
119  always() << " In Map 1: " << Gaudi::Utils::toString( map1.end() != map1.find( m_key.value() ) ) << endmsg;
120  always() << " In Map 2: " << Gaudi::Utils::toString( map2.end() != map2.find( m_key.value() ) ) << endmsg;
121  always() << " In Map 3: " << Gaudi::Utils::toString( map3.end() != map3.find( m_key.value() ) ) << endmsg;
122  always() << " In Map 4: " << Gaudi::Utils::toString( map4.end() != map4.find( m_key.value() ) ) << endmsg;
123 
124  always() << " In Map01: " << Gaudi::Utils::toString( map01.end() != map01.find( m_key ) ) << endmsg;
125  always() << " In Map02: " << Gaudi::Utils::toString( map02.end() != map02.find( m_key ) ) << endmsg;
126  always() << " In Map03: " << Gaudi::Utils::toString( map03.end() != map03.find( m_key ) ) << endmsg;
127  always() << " In Map04: " << Gaudi::Utils::toString( map04.end() != map04.find( m_key ) ) << endmsg;
128 
129  std::string akey = "rrr";
130 
131  always() << "check for std::string key " << Gaudi::Utils::toString( akey ) << endmsg;
132 
133  always() << " In Map 1: " << Gaudi::Utils::toString( map1.end() != map1.find( akey ) ) << endmsg;
134  always() << " In Map 2: " << Gaudi::Utils::toString( map2.end() != map2.find( akey ) ) << endmsg;
135  always() << " In Map 3: " << Gaudi::Utils::toString( map3.end() != map3.find( akey ) ) << endmsg;
136  always() << " In Map 4: " << Gaudi::Utils::toString( map4.end() != map4.find( akey ) ) << endmsg;
137 
138  always() << " In Map01: " << Gaudi::Utils::toString( map01.end() != map01.find( akey ) ) << endmsg;
139  always() << " In Map02: " << Gaudi::Utils::toString( map02.end() != map02.find( akey ) ) << endmsg;
140  always() << " In Map03: " << Gaudi::Utils::toString( map03.end() != map03.find( akey ) ) << endmsg;
141  always() << " In Map04: " << Gaudi::Utils::toString( map04.end() != map04.find( akey ) ) << endmsg;
142 
143  return StatusCode::SUCCESS;
144 }
